You're perfect pitch
symmetrical bliss
apostrophes and commas
that drip with success

you are truly blessed

poetic finesse

the attire of a squire

o those roses you gather

the eyes that adore you

you must fight off with a stick!!

my dear darling darkboy
how i'd love
for a moment
to be the keys that
pound beneath you

o YES!!!!!!!!!!!!!!
